Overview

Ideally located in Quend-Plage, between the Somme Bay and the Authie Bay, Domaine de Diane enjoys a privileged setting at the heart of a protected natural park. The atmosphere is both family-friendly and elegant, perfect for unwinding or sharing lively moments together. The accommodations, from fully equipped cottages to high-end villas, blend harmoniously into the landscape.rnrnThe estate is renowned for the quality of its facilities, its environmental commitment and its personalised welcome.     What kind of natural setting will you find at Domaine de Diane?
    Domaine de Diane offers a strongly natural setting, at the heart of a protected park. Local tourism sources describe an 80-hectare estate made up of pine forests, dunes, ponds and wild spaces. This layout creates a different atmosphere from a more conventional campsite, since the stay is built around nature, space and tranquillity. The ponds, trees and local wildlife all add to the feeling of getting away from it all. The estate therefore suits holidaymakers looking for a stay in the Somme Bay with more breathing room around their accommodation.     What types of accommodation can you book at Domaine de Diane?
    At Domaine de Diane, you can choose between several types of accommodation depending on the level of comfort you're after. The official website distinguishes between the Hotel-Spa and wellness section, with rooms and villas, and the outdoor accommodation, with mobile homes, cottages and chalets. The mobile homes available for rent are described as spacious, bright and well-equipped, with capacities of up to 6 people depending on the model. This variety lets you tailor the stay to a weekend, a week, or a longer holiday. The outdoor accommodation suits families wanting more independence, while the hotel-spa is more geared towards wellness stays.     What leisure activities are available on site at Domaine de Diane?
    Domaine de Diane offers plenty of leisure activities right on site, letting you vary your days without always having to leave the estate. The official website mentions entertainment programmes, a toy library, a mountain-bike and fitness trail, exercise areas, ponds, a carp fishing area, tennis, padel and table tennis. These facilities suit both families and holidaymakers who like to stay active during their holiday. Children can enjoy spaces designed for them, while adults have access to sporting or more relaxed activities. This variety makes it possible to plan a balanced stay between sea, nature and leisure.     Can you easily eat on site at Domaine de Diane?
    You can easily eat on site at Domaine de Diane thanks to the dining areas listed on the official website. The estate's sections mention several restaurants, including Le Jardin, Dune and La Paillote. This offering lets you alternate between meals in your accommodation, dining on site and outings to Quend or Fort-Mahon. It's handy if you don't want to cook every day or want to enjoy a meal after a day at the beach. The outdoor accommodation also lets you keep some independence for breakfasts and simple meals.
